About Motherwell - show infohide info
Motherwell is a large burgh in North Lanarkshire, situated between Glasgow and Edinburgh. The town has a population 30,311. The town has been the steel capital of Scotland, nicknamed Steelopolis, with its skyline dominated by the water tower and three cooling towers of the Ravenscraig steel plant which closed in 1992. With the closure of the plant, the town suffered high unemployment and economic decline. The closure of plant also signalled the end of large scale steel production in Scotland, as the plant had one of the longest continuous casting (concast), hot rolling, steel production facilities in the world before it was decomissioned. Today, the town has undergone a revival thanks to a number of call centres and businesses setting up in newly created business parks such as the Strathclyde Business Park. The town is home to North Lanarkshire Council, which covers a population of 327,000 (93,000 being in Motherwell and Wishaw), as well as Strathclyde Police's 'N' division. Motherwell is well linked to the rail network, with trains serving Milngavie, Lanark, Dalmuir, Cumbernauld and Glasgow Central. Additionally, the town is called at by some Virgin West Coast services between Glasgow and London, and Virgin Cross Country services to the South Coast. GNER also serve the station with their Glasgow - London Kings Cross services. Nearby towns to Motherwell inlcude Wishaw, Larkhall, Hamilton, East Kilbride, Glasgow, Coatbridge and Airdrie.
